Subject: pci id 14e4:4727 (bcm4313) status?

>>> On Thu, Nov 4, 2010 at 1:21 PM, Ariel Pedraza<pedrazaa@yahoo.com> ?wrote:
>>>>
>>>> I have the 14e4:4727 and using the brcm80211, this is an example of what
>>>> I get and the status of each commands:
>>>>
>>>> airmon-ng #ok
>>>> airmon-ng stop wlan0 #ok
>>>> ifconfig wlan0 #ok
>>>> macchanger --mac yy:yy:yy:yy:yy:yy wlan0 #ok
>>>> airmon-ng start wlan0 #ok
>>>> airodump-ng mon0 #ok
>>>> airodump-ng -c canal -w nomarch --bssid xx:xx:xx:xx:xx:xx mon0 ?#ok, no
>>>> datas
>>>>
>>>> In other terminal:
>>>> aireplay-ng -1 0 -a xx:xx:xx:xx:xx:xx -h yy:yy:yy:yy:yy:yy mon0 #ok,
>>>> autentication succesful
>>>> aireplay-ng -3 -b xx:xx:xx:xx:xx:xx -h yy:yy:yy:yy:yy:yy mon0 #ok, supose
>>>> to increment datas but NOP!!!
>>>>
>>>> In other terminal:
>>>> aircrack-ng -b xx:xx:xx:xx:xx:xx nomarch.cap #ok, no datas...
>>>>
>>>> So... when do you think that the brcm80211 implemetation will be ready to
>>>> capture datas?
>>>
>>> Hmm... filter configuration issue? Apparently the "pass other-BSS
>>> data" filter flag is not getting written to the hardware. (Do we even
>>> have such a flag in the brcm80211 FW?)
>>
>>>
>>> Can you see any data packets in Wireshark on the monitor interface?
>>
>> The following flags should all work with the brcm80211 FW:
>>
>> ? ? ? ?MCTL_KEEPBADFCS
>> ? ? ? ?MCTL_KEEPCONTROL
>> ? ? ? ?MCTL_PROMISC
>> ? ? ? ?MCTL_BCNS_PROMISC
>>
>> The only one that's hooked up in the driver at the moment is
>> MCTL_BCNS_PROMISC (for FIF_BCN_PRBRESP_PROMISC). ?I haven't taken a look at
>> what it would take to enable monitor mode in the driver yet (setting up the
>> monitor interface, etc).
>
> For raw monitor mode, all but KEEPBADFCS are needed. If the "fcsfail"
> monitor mode flag is also set, KEEPBADFCS should be enabled too.
> For cooked monitor, AFAIK only KEEPCONTROL (and perhaps BCNS_PROMISC)
> are needed.
>
> However, do not set these based on interface type - use the FIF_ flags instead.

BTW, please consider a KEEPBADPLCP flag in the next firmware release -
it is needed for implementing the "plcpfail" monitor flag.
